In an effort to expand access to Atlassian Cloud services and better enable IT communication with AppState users, AppState will claim all Atlassian Cloud accounts that are associated with an appstate.edu email address on January 1, 2022.  At this time, Atlassian Cloud users will no longer be able to remove their accounts from AppState control, nor delete these accounts.

If you use your Atlassian Cloud account strictly for AppState business or education, then you don't need to take any action.

If you have used your AppState email address to do personal work on the Atlassian Cloud (such as Trello or Bitbucket Cloud), you may wish to change your Atlassian Cloud email address to a personal email address in advance of the change on January 1, 2022.

Please make sure you want to delete your appstate Atlassian Account before following these steps.  Alternatively, you can take ownership of your Atlassian account by changing your email address to your personal email before Jan 1, 2022.


  1. Go to atlassian.com

  2. Look in the top-right corner after the page loads.
    1. If you see "My Account," click it and then select Log In.  Log in to Atlassian however you would normally.

  3. In the top-right corner, if you see your picture or your initials click that and select Profile


  4. Select "Email" on the left side.


  5. Enter your personal email address and Save Changes.

  6. If you previously used Google, Microsoft, or Apple to log into Atlassian, you may have to perform a password reset using your personal email address.
